I am the proud owner of a new Cub Cadet GT2550. I mowed my hilly 2 acres with it already and I am quite happy with it so far. I was considering a John Deere X320, but felt the GT2550 was much more tractor for less money. And since I have a lot of hills, I was more comfortable the the cast iron serviceable rearend and shaft drive. So far so good.

Now a question. It seems that reverse is very slow on the GT 2550. It seems I have to push the reverse pedal the whole way to the floor to get it to move and then it is slow. Is this normal or should I contact the dealer and have it checked out?
